Kelsey Grammer Hints at Possible Future for 'Frasier' Revival After Paramount+ Cancellation

The actor remains optimistic about finding a new home for the rebooted series, which ended after two seasons, and teases a potential reunion with Ted Danson.

  • The 'Frasier' revival was canceled by Paramount+ in January 2025 after two seasons, citing lack of promotion and passion from the streaming platform's administration.
  • Kelsey Grammer, who reprised his role as Dr. Frasier Crane, expressed optimism about the show being picked up by another network or streaming service.
  • Grammer revealed that CBS Studios, the revival's producer, plans to shop the series to other outlets to continue its story.
  • The actor teased the possibility of a reunion with his former 'Cheers' co-star Ted Danson, potentially reprising the role of Sam Malone in a future season.
  • The revival followed Frasier Crane's return to Boston, focusing on his reconnection with his son Freddy and his new role as a Harvard professor.
